Output 90d086058aceeeae9e50e0993f853417aac07d1f1b1c7402c5d687aef6024468:1

value
18641000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7dc7e7b510b5f70e4706e014c38397a27dcfeed OP_EQUAL
address
3MNPLz1kwBqP3D4WEeiRcWXxCAWJV39SsD
transaction
90d086058aceeeae9e50e0993f853417aac07d1f1b1c7402c5d687aef6024468
confirmations
364681
spent
true